it's not always a reaction to cows milk, sometimes babies just get colds. mine was intolerant to cows milk (and i didn't realise it, the health visitor told me i was being silly when i mentioned it as a possibility) but only got the usual amount of colds per year and wasn't mucus-y in between the colds. cows milk does promote the build up of mucus though so in older children perhaps it could be limited during times of colds and snot.
i found that raising the top end of the cot slightly worked well, i also used snufflebabe. i use eucalyptus oil in burners too, or put olbas oil into the burner and into the bath. i don't think you can use those with tiny babies though. i recently bought a karvol plug and it's suitable for babies of 3 months plus, you have to put pads into it and it heats them up to release vapours, they are a bit expensive though.
i think that for a tiny baby when most products aren't suitable letting them sleep in the rocker/pram/car seat is the best option as it lets them sleep in a raised position. having just had an awful sinus infection myself i can confirm that being raised up makes a massive difference to breathing, although swallowing all that rubbish tends to make you vomit. still, what's a bit of vomit if you get a good night's sleep lol!52% tight0 -
